Incarcerated During a Pandemic

This chapter examines the severe impacts of COVID-19 on incarcerated individuals, highlighting the challenges of overcrowding and inadequate hygiene. It reveals personal accounts and insights from correctional staff, showcasing the emotional toll and health risks faced by inmates during the pandemic's early months.
